Transaction 8679646caaab60e48cee5992902161a83c8fdb920dae64b37110f7ffdcc1eb07

1 Input
2 Outputs
  • 8679646caaab60e48cee5992902161a83c8fdb920dae64b37110f7ffdcc1eb07:0
  • value  3393159
    address  35TviLjv9zD91Q9N7X3kcqstZdBusTpqNe
  • 8679646caaab60e48cee5992902161a83c8fdb920dae64b37110f7ffdcc1eb07:1
  • value  84979040
    address  3Evye3PTeEXs318CqsmiF3kyWGBwgTwi7E